System Configuration & Integration Options

A complete S7-400H redundant system typically includes:

  • Dual CPU 412-3H modules with synchronized operation
  • Redundant power supply modules (PS 407 series recommended)
  • Fiber-optic synchronization cables for inter-CPU communication
  • Redundant communication processors (CP 443-1 for PROFINET, CP 443-5 for PROFIBUS)
  • Distributed I/O via ET 200M/ET 200S redundant stations
  • Engineering workstation with STEP 7 Professional software
  • HMI/SCADA integration via WinCC or third-party systems

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How does the CPU 412-3H redundant controller integrate with existing S7-400 systems?
A: The CPU 412-3H requires a dedicated S7-400H rack with redundant backplane and synchronization modules. It cannot be directly retrofitted into standard S7-400 racks. Migration from simplex to redundant architecture requires system re-engineering, including dual power supplies, fiber-optic sync cables, and STEP 7 program adaptation for redundancy management.

Q: What is the maximum I/O capacity supported by a single CPU 412-3H redundant pair?
A: Each CPU 412-3H supports up to 65,536 digital I/O points and 4,096 analog I/O channels across distributed ET 200 stations. Actual capacity depends on communication bandwidth, scan cycle requirements, and program complexity.

Q: What are the environmental and installation requirements for the CPU 412-3H?
A: Operating temperature range: 0°C to 60°C (horizontal mounting); storage: -40°C to +70°C. Relative humidity: 5% to 95% (non-condensing). Protection rating: IP20 (requires installation in enclosed control cabinets). Avoid exposure to corrosive gases, excessive vibration, or electromagnetic interference.

Q: Does the CPU 412-3H support remote monitoring and data acquisition?
A: Yes. Via PROFINET or Industrial Ethernet (with CP 443-1 module), the CPU 412-3H supports OPC UA, Modbus TCP, and S7 communication protocols for integration with SCADA systems, cloud platforms, and IIoT gateways. Real-time process data, alarms, and diagnostics can be accessed remotely.

Q: Is the CPU 412-3H suitable for safety-critical applications (SIL 3)?
A: Yes. The CPU 412-3H is certified for SIL 3 applications when configured according to Siemens safety guidelines. For dedicated safety functions (emergency shutdown, fire & gas detection), consider pairing with Siemens Safety Integrated modules or dedicated F-CPUs for enhanced safety integrity.
